Members of the law enforcement quickly learned how to spot suspicious behavior.
Leto [7]
The complete predicate of a sentence tells what the subject does or is. It includes a verb and all other details that describe what is going on. example: My father fixed the dryer. The simple predicate is the main verb in the predicate that tells what the subject does. Therefore, the simple predicate is learned. I hope that this is the answer that you were looking for and it has helped you.
